reality is that we are not going to be able to fix everything at once. there is also so much money and the cap.

so where to start....I would say with the OL

the first couple of moves needs to be to sign one of the FA guards (Evans, Blalock or mankins). then draft a tackle (even if we have to trade down a few spots but not a lot).

that should help solidify the OL a little more, specially on the right side. I would love to replace Gurode but you can't fix everything in one off season and he is still servicable. that would leave Kosier's spot....tough call.

then we need to find a saftey. just one to start with and that alone can help the defense tremendously. almost no team boasts 2 top notch safties. so either target Atogwe or spend a high draft pick on a saftey....so the first two picks should be focused on saftey help and OL, specially tackle.

target some MLBs in the draft. forget about those who wow you with numbers. find football players. even those that give you first two downs.

NT and DEs for 3-4 can be found earlier. I think Brent is got a future. he has some work left to do, but he can be decent for a while. Igor needs tob e replaced and I would consider moving Rat to his spot or the other DE.

just addressing 4 spots on this team will make a world of difference along with more physical, REAL training camp this time around.
 
I'll go with a GM that knows what he is doing.
 
For the defense:

New DC and new staff with an attacking 3-4 scheme.

Find another pass rusher to compliment Ware (maybe Quinn or Fairley depending on how the draft plays out).

At least one new safety to replace Ball.

Try to find a monster NT to start.

Lee in for Brooking. Maybe move Spencer to ILB if we get a new OLB starter.

For the offense:

Two new OL: RT and RG. You can leave everything else as is. Preferably one of the OL is a young FA and one is a 1st or 2nd round pick who can start immediately.
